ci: Update the Fedora image to F33
authorMatthias Clasen <mclasen@redhat.com>
Fri, 12 Feb 2021 03:02:39 +0000 (22:02 -0500)
committerMatthias Clasen <mclasen@redhat.com>
Fri, 12 Feb 2021 03:02:39 +0000 (22:02 -0500)
.gitlab-ci.yml
.gitlab-ci/fedora-base.Dockerfile
.gitlab-ci/fedora.Dockerfile

index 6c6d15c8a742723fdc587eddd8e0b2203b08e5c1..8476616092676e44b7be7cbb920b0f2d987d0018 100644 (file)
@@ -24,7 +24,7 @@ variables:
   BACKEND_FLAGS: "-Dx11-backend=true -Dwayland-backend=true -Dbroadway-backend=true"
   FEATURE_FLAGS: "-Dvulkan=enabled -Dcloudproviders=enabled"
   MESON_TEST_TIMEOUT_MULTIPLIER: 3
-  FEDORA_IMAGE: "registry.gitlab.gnome.org/gnome/gtk/fedora:v27"
+  FEDORA_IMAGE: "registry.gitlab.gnome.org/gnome/gtk/fedora:v28"
   FLATPAK_IMAGE: "registry.gitlab.gnome.org/gnome/gnome-runtime-images/gnome:master"
   DOCS_IMAGE: "registry.gitlab.gnome.org/gnome/gtk/fedora-docs:v25"
 
index 613d492d344ce1ab5ff6cadff3b34cdaa563d943..04377f05e5cccf9dda983d9509279e103670fbea 100644 (file)
@@ -1,4 +1,4 @@
-FROM fedora:31
+FROM fedora:33
 
 RUN dnf -y install \
     adwaita-icon-theme \
@@ -66,7 +66,7 @@ RUN dnf -y install \
     mesa-dri-drivers \
     mesa-libEGL-devel \
     mesa-libGLES-devel \
-    mesa-libwayland-egl-devel \
+    meson \
     ninja-build \
     pango-devel \
     pcre-devel \
@@ -87,6 +87,3 @@ RUN dnf -y install \
     which \
     xorg-x11-server-Xvfb \
  && dnf clean all
-
-RUN pip3 install meson==0.55.3
-
index ddcc18f2878206dc929b3023f66d7eee0205b65d..c64f0947b7cb365b7a512548981fed6898a685d9 100644 (file)
@@ -1,4 +1,4 @@
-FROM registry.gitlab.gnome.org/gnome/gtk/fedora-base:v27
+FROM registry.gitlab.gnome.org/gnome/gtk/fedora-base:v28
 
 # Enable sudo for wheel users
 RUN sed -i -e 's/# %wheel/%wheel/' -e '0,/%wheel/{s/%wheel/# %wheel/}' /etc/sudoers